What You Should Know

Bai Shala Coconut Strawberry reads like a modern, ready‑to‑drink take on tropical refreshment: an 18 fl oz PET bottle of lightly flavored water that sits in the chilled enhanced‑water or flavored‑beverage aisle, often shelved near coconut waters, vitamin waters and low‑calorie sports drinks. Shoppers reach for it when they want a hydrating, low‑calorie option for a hot day, a pool party, a post‑workout cool‑down or a road trip stash for the glove box. The Bai brand leans into wellness‑forward, millennial and Gen‑Z demographics with aspirational tropical imagery, antioxidant claims, and the “WonderWater” lifestyle tone — framed as exotic, modern and slightly luxurious. Labels emphasize health halos: low calories (10 kcal), 1 g sugar, “no artificial sweeteners,” added antioxidants and zinc, and recycled‑plastic packaging; it is not organic and does not use whole fruit pieces. In plain processing terms, this is an industrially formulated beverage built from concentrates, extracts and functional additives rather than intact foods. Sensory notes: chilled, the drink delivers a clean, slightly viscous mouthfeel (acacia gum) with a mild coconut backbone and a strawberry‑like top note that comes from natural flavors and fruit concentrates, finished by sweet, cooling stevia/monk‑fruit sweetness and a touch of minerality from sea salt and electrolytes. Rituals around it are grab‑and‑go — tossed into a gym bag, sipped poolside, or served at casual brunches for a colorful, low‑sugar alternative to soda. Packaging is lightweight, recyclable PET with bright, tropical labeling designed for impulse appeal.

Ultra-Processing Assessment

NOVA Score:4 / 4

Ultra-Processed

Why this score?

This is a ready‑to‑drink industrial beverage containing concentrated juices, multiple extracts and additives (acacia gum, citric/malic acids), non‑nutritive sweetener extracts and added isolated nutrients, which are characteristic of ultra‑processed foods.
